Open Forum: Mary Hunt asked about the second tee plans for the disk golf park. Plans are in
the works; staff is going to try to build them off-site and install. The signs for the new hours of
Madison Central Park have been installed. Hours changed due to noise complaints, but the
walking path is still open 24 hours.

New Business: The steering committee for the Parks Master Plan is being formed. Sherii
Farmer and Marty Hunt are going to be the representatives from the Parks Board on the
committee. The first public event will be next Tuesday, February 15 at the Venue. Citizens will
1
be introduced to Pros Consulting and Confluence, who are going to be working on the master
plan. A presentation and storyboards will be available for citizens to review and give input as to
what they would like see in Derby’s Parks in the future. Stakeholder meetings are also kicking
off. Staff will be meeting the DRC and Senior Center and USD 260 among others to gain input.
The PUF Board is encouraged to attend community meetings and please wear your green shirts
as representatives of the board.
The Planting Guide is going to be updated in 2022. Jason Griffin and Bonnie Thieme,
Horticulturist will be updating it. Several ideas for enhancing it were recommended. It will be
presented to City Council in April.
The PUF Board will be manning a booth at Spring Into Art in April and our Horticulturist will be
adding an activity for the kids.
There is an open seat on the Parks Board. We will be advertising the vacancy soon, please tell
anyone that you think would interested in serving.
The dog was park closed for the first time due to the wet conditions. The grass is getting highly
damaged; staff is attempting to let it dry out before dogs are allowed back in there.
